Purpose
The purpose of this standard is to provide measurements that evaluate the performance of power-line interference filters in practical installations involving varying load and source impedances. These factors are not usually considered in design and performance verification testing of EMI/RFI filters. Both manufacturers and end users should benefit from this standard that defines the ranges and environment, expected effects, and test methods to verify filter attributes.
